fuel and spark no start
ctr motor in my eg has fuel pressure and and spark, why would it not start , also no oil pressure using gsr pickup, b20 oil case with ctr pump gear? cranks over fine only 60% to 80% on a compresion test.
u need fuel spark and TIMING. check ur plugs and wires/timing for dumb mistakes. I had my **** backward the other day felt like an ******* when I figured what it was.
Check the clearance between the bottom of the oil pan and the pick-up, if the clearance is too small can contribute to no/low oil pressure.

I put a B20 in my friend's 2k civic a few weeks ago and had the same problem....fuel and spark, no cranking going on! Believe it or not it was the distributor..was sending spark, but would not crank the car! Changed the distributor, and walla! FIRE. may work for you too, just something else you could check, GL.
